Re: Distributor??
There is potental that moisture can get in the cap and cause it to corrode the contact points in the cap and on the rotor you will know if they are and can clean them with some lite sand paper or some steel wool and see if it improves. also make sure the distributer is tight if it has become loose and retarded it self (tipped towards the front of the car) I will created a miss and have very little power.
